Is Calder safer than Little Harwood & Whitebirk?
Calder has a safety score of 72/100 (Safe) and recorded 120 crimes in the last 12 months. Little Harwood & Whitebirk has a safety score of 8/100 (High Crime) with 2,284 crimes. Calder scores higher on the CrimeRadar safety index.
What is the crime trend in Calder vs Little Harwood & Whitebirk?
Calder shows a year-on-year crime trend of +15.4% — meaning total crimes rose compared to the same period the prior year. Little Harwood & Whitebirk shows -3.2% (falling). A downward trend is a positive sign for an area.
What types of crime are most common in Calder and Little Harwood & Whitebirk?
In Calder, the most recorded crime category over the last 12 months is Anti-Social Behaviour (44 incidents). In Little Harwood & Whitebirk, it is Violent Crime (823 incidents). The full breakdown by category is shown in the chart above.
How does anti-social behaviour compare between Calder and Little Harwood & Whitebirk?
Calder recorded 44 anti-social behaviour incidents in the last 12 months, while Little Harwood & Whitebirk recorded 566. Anti-social behaviour includes rowdiness, nuisance and disorder that disrupts daily life but may not result in a criminal charge.
How do violent crime levels compare in Calder vs Little Harwood & Whitebirk?
Violent crime in Calder totalled 38 incidents over the last 12 months, compared to 823 in Little Harwood & Whitebirk. Violent crime includes assault with and without injury, harassment, and public order offences.
How many crimes were recorded in Calder and Little Harwood & Whitebirk in the previous year?
In the 12 months prior to the most recent period, Calder recorded 104 crimes (now 120, a change of +15.4%). Little Harwood & Whitebirk recorded 2,360 crimes previously (now 2,284, -3.2%).
What is the resolution rate for crimes in Calder and Little Harwood & Whitebirk?
The resolution rate is the percentage of recorded crimes that resulted in a formal outcome — such as a charge, caution, penalty notice, or community resolution. Calder has a resolution rate of 0% and Little Harwood & Whitebirk has 28.3%. A higher rate indicates police are more frequently resolving reported crimes in that area.

What data is used to compare Calder and Little Harwood & Whitebirk?
CrimeRadar uses 36 months of official recorded crime data from the UK Police API, updated each month. The safety score combines crime volume relative to the force average, year-on-year trend direction, and resolution rate. All figures are based on crimes recorded within each police-defined neighbourhood boundary.
